Application
Thermoguard Fire Varnish Basecoat
1 coat @ 150 microns wet, 75 microns dft. Leave 36+ hrs in good drying conditions. When hard dry apply:
Thermoguard Professional Lacquer Topcoat
1* coat @ 60 microns wet, 30 mirons dft.
* Apply 1 full or 2 light coats Professional Lacquer by spray, roller or brush maintaining a wet edge. (Note - spray broad flush areas). For Colours, Wood stain shades or for high UV areas 2nd coat after 2 > 36 hrs
If 36+ hrs delay before 2nd coat, abrade to remove gloss & leave overnight to condition before applying 2nd coat.
Equipment
Conventional pressure pot & gun (best) 5 > 10% Thinners.
Airless - 11 thou tip. thin 0 > 5% Thinners.
Avoid solvent contamination of basecoat or water/basecoat contamination.
Application to OSB/Sterling Board
This is a board made of chips of wood glued together to form a hard non-decorative board. If it needs fire coating, Thermoguard Fire Varnish or Thermoguard Timbercoat BS Class 1/0 & EN Class B System can be applied to it. However we first recommend a test is carried out by applying a small amount of the proposed coating to the board to check for "cessing" / "cissing" (where coating gathers together in lumps and may leaving bare patches between). If this occurs the board should be degreased/cleaned and allowed to dry before testing again - if this still does not provide a satisfactory application please contact our Technical Team for further advice on 0113 2455450 (option 2) or send a message to [email protected].

Ensure surfaces are thoroughly dry – max 18% moisture content.
Maximum relative humidity RH 75%. Ensure adequate ventilation.
Minimum air temperature 6°C. Minimum surface temperature 3°C above dewpoint– avoid condensation.
New Fire Regulations & Tests Explained
The new fire standard BS EN test lasts 20 mins. with airflow replaces the old BS 476 tests which lasted 10 mins and strangely restricted airflow.
The new standard for flamespread and heat release Class B replaces Class O.
The new BS EN tests also monitor -
Smoke & Gas “s” – s1 + s2 are none or very low & compliant, s3 = moderate smoke, s4 = heavy smoke.
Flaming Droplets or Airborne particulates – dO is none, d1 = low, d2 = moderate d3 = high levels.
